WebIn linear algebra, a symmetric matrix is a square matrix that is equal to its transpose. Formally, Because equal matrices have equal dimensions, only square matrices can be symmetric. The entries of a symmetric matrix are symmetric with respect to the main diagonal. So if denotes the entry in the th row and th column then for all indices and WebAnswer: A symmetric matrix refers to a square matrix whose transpose is equal to it. Furthermore, it is possible only for square matrices to be symmetric because equal matrices have equal dimensions.
